Enterprise wrestling champion sets sights on 2028 Olympics

ENTERPRISE | RICKEY STOKES NEWS

After winning four consecutive state wrestling titles, Enterprise High School senior Mackenzie Schultz is now focused on an even bigger goal: the 2028 Olympic Games.

Schultz says her drive comes from her passion for the sport, calling wrestling more of a lifestyle than a hobby. Her coach, Billy Landry, says her intense work ethic and leadership set her apart, adding that she has become like an assistant coach to younger athletes.

In addition to wrestling, Schultz trains in judo and jiu-jitsu. She has competed internationally in judo, earning third-place finishes at the Pan American Games, Cadet Worlds, and Junior Pan competitions. She competes under 170 pounds in judo and 152 pounds in wrestling.

Training seven days a week, Schultz balances home workouts with travel practices, all while preparing for her next major event — the IBJJF Pan Championship in March.

As she finishes her final year as a Wildcat, Schultz says she’s proud to represent Enterprise on the world stage and is determined to qualify for the 2028 Olympics in judo.
